Frequently asked questions
What happens when a hydraulic seal fails?
A failed hydraulic seal causes fluid leakage, leading to reduced system pressure, loss of machine force and speed, increased oil consumption, environmental contamination, and potential damage to pumps and valves operating without adequate fluid supply.
How can I identify worn seals in my drilling equipment?
Signs of seal wear include visible fluid leaks around cylinders and connections, reduced hydraulic system pressure, slower machine movements, increased oil consumption, and contaminated hydraulic fluid appearing milky or discolored.
